Wedding Dance Songs
Weddings should be fun. It is a time of celebration and great joy. After the ceremony, pictures, and dinner, it is time for dancing. Choosing the right music and songs to get the party off to great start is important. One nice way to check out music today is through itunes, where you can play 30 second clips of any song. It is good to try and play a variety of music, to consider both young and older people. Pick songs that are fun to dance to. Remember that this is a wedding, so don’t pick songs about breaking up, broken hearts, ex wives, etc. Here are some of my favorites.
